RT Middleware

By Takeshi Sasaki

Going back to explaining a little bit on what we do here in the lab, we have a great introduction and a little video of what RT Middleware is by our resident researcher.

Recently, OMG (Object Management Group, http://www.omg.org/) adopted the RTC (Robotic Technology Component) Specification that defined a component model for development of robotic systems.
In module or component based systems, independent elements (module or component) of functions of the systems are first developed and the systems are then built by combining the modules.
The modularization increases maintainability and reusability of the elements.
Moreover, flexible and scalable system can be realized since the system is reconfigured by adding or replacing only related components. RTCBasedServiceRobot
OpenRTM-aist (http://www.is.aist.go.jp/rt/OpenRTM-aist/) is a middleware that complies with the standard.
It also includes a template code generator which makes a source code of a component from the specification of the component (e.g. number of I/O ports, etc.) and a system design tool which provides graphical user interface to change the connection of components and start/stop the system.
The attached video shows an example of system construction using the OpenRTM-aist.

A cute robot

Submitted by Lazlo Jeni

Robotics is not always just about how to make the best interaction, or the best interface. Sometimes it is also about having people to have some kind of reaction for the robot.

In NYU an Art student build a somehow simple robot and made it walk through the streets of New York. It did not had any kind of sensor, it only walked in a straight line.

The objective was to watch what would be people’s reaction when they see the robot encounter some obstacle, whether they help or just stand by.
